As of May 18, 2021, the average annual salary for Mining Engineer in Washington is $75,659, equivalent to $36 per hour, $1,455 weekly, or $6,305 monthly. These figures, sourced from Salary.com’s real-time job posting scans, highlight competitive earning potential for Mining Engineer in cities like Santa Clara, San Jose, and Fremont.

Annually Salaries for Mining Engineer in Washington vary widely, spanning from $60,617 to $86,656. Most professionals fall between the 25th percentile ($67,785) and 75th percentile ($81,415), while top earners (90th percentile) make $86,656 per year.
